The Timco VDE Screwdriver is an essential, professionally rated tool for electricians and technicians, engineered for absolute safety when working with live electrical components. It is individually tested to 10,000 volts AC to ensure safe operation on systems up to 1,000 volts AC, providing a critical margin of safety and peace of mind.
Crafted from durable S2 hardened carbon steel, the blade offers exceptional strength and longevity. This material provides 25% greater torsional strength compared to traditional chrome vanadium, with a hardness rating of 55HRC, ensuring the tip resists wear and deformation for reliable performance.
